Product Description

Electronic ballast Quicktronic QT-M 2 x 26-42W - OSRAM - Supply voltage: 230…240 V - power frequency: 0, 50…60 Hz - Mains voltage: 198…254 V - For usage in emergency lighting systems in accordance with EN 50172/DIN VDE 0108-100 - Same light current with direct and alternating voltage - Battery voltage may decrease down to 176 V, ignition may be above 198 V - Perfect bulb warm start for usage with motion detector, bulb start within 1 s. - In the event of a temporary disruption to the voltage supply ( - In suitable lamps from the protection rating II, the connection of the function grounding can be omitted - Automatic safety shut down with defective bulb and at the end of the bulb's lifespan (EoL) - Automatic turn on after bulb change - Energy efficiency index EEI = A2 - Safety: according to EN 61347-2-3 - Bulb mode: according to EN 60929 - Noise suppression: according to EN 55015:2006+A1:2007/CISPR 15 - Mains power harmonic: according to EN 61000-3-2 - Immunity, stability according to EN 61547
